Realme GT 6 review – GSMArena.com tests

Introduction

The global version of the Realme GT 6 is finally here and it looks beyond promising. The phone shines with a cool and stylish design, a premium Dolby Vision OLED, one of the fastest chips, top-tier cameras, long battery life and fast charging!

Realme’s GT lineup is back to global markets, and it comes with a new design that turns heads with its two-tone back combining glossy parts with a silver mirror finish.

Realme is advertising the 6.78-inch OLED screen on the GT 6 for its LTPO OLED panel with high resolution, 120Hz refresh rate, 10-bit color depth and Dolby Vision support. But most importantly – for the highest peak brightness on the market – up to 6,000 nits.

The GT 6 employs the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 chipset, which has become somewhat of a maker-favorite platform on the market for its flagship-grade performance but not a flagship-grade cost. Realme promises high-end vapor-chamber cooling, fast LPDDR5X RAM and UFS4 storage.

The GT 6 has a 50MP primary camera with a top-tier Sony LYT-808 sensor, a 50MP telephoto for 2x optical and 4x lossless zoom, and an 8MP ultrawide camera. There is also a 32MP imager for selfies.

Finally, the Realme GT 6 comes with a super large 5,500 mAh battery, and it supports blazing-fast 120W SuperVOOC charging. Realme promises 50% of the charge in just 10 minutes!

Realme GT 6 specs at a glance:

  • Body: 162.0×75.1×8.7mm, 191g; Gorilla Glass Victus 2 front, plastic frame, plastic back.
  • Display: 6.78″ LTPO AMOLED, 1B colors, 120Hz, HDR, 1600 nits (HBM), 6000 nits (peak), 1264x2780px resolution, 19.79:9 aspect ratio, 450ppi.
  • Chipset: Qualcomm SM8635 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 (4 nm): Octa-core (1×3.0 GHz Cortex-X4 & 4×2.8 GHz Cortex-A720 & 3×2.0 GHz Cortex-A520); Adreno 735.
  • Memory: 256GB 12GB RAM, 512GB 16GB RAM; UFS 4.0.
  • OS/Software: Android 14, Realme UI 5.0.
  • Rear camera: Wide (main): 50 MP, f/1.7, 26mm, 1/1.4″, multi-directional PDAF, OIS; Telephoto: 50MP, f/2.0, 47mm, 1/2.8″, PDAF; Ultra wide angle: 8 MP, f/2.2, 16mm, 112˚, 1/4.0″.
  • Front camera: 32 MP, f/2.5, 22mm, 1/2.74″.
  • Video capture: Rear camera: 4K@30/60fps, 1080p@30/60/120fps; Front camera: 4K@30fps.
  • Battery: 5500mAh; 120W wired, 1-50% in 10 min (advertised).
  • Connectivity: 5G; Dual SIM; Wi-Fi 6; BT 5.4, aptX HD, LHDC; NFC; Infrared blaster.
  • Misc: Fingerprint reader (under display, optical); stereo speakers.

The Realme GT 6 doesn’t have official ingress protection, but according to Realme’s press materials – it can be operated normally when covered in water droplets.

Unboxing the Realme GT 6

The Realme GT 6 ships in a regular-sized paper box, which contains a 120W charger with a USB-A port, a 12A-rated USB-C-A cable and a dark gray silicone case.
